Hi, I am confused by the info provided above. With a single ticket, you initially wrote that it can only be used once on the specific journey. Yet later , you wrote that one can transfer to another bus or train , as long as it is within the allowed zones time limit.

Which is right?

Hi Confused.

A ticket can be used on multiply forms of transport including metro, bus, train and water taxi. You can switch between the above including from bus to bus, etc. As long as you travel within the time limit on your ticket and within the allowed zones, you can travel on that single ticket.

For example: A 2 zone ticket (min. ticket you can buy), you can travel for 1 hour and 15 min and that can be used in any 2 adjoining zones. If you started in Copenhagen central which is zone 1, you can use your 2 zone ticket in zone 1 and 2, or you can use it in zone 1 and 3. Both zones 2 and 3 border on zone 1. If you need to travel further out you buy a 3 zone or up to 9 zones. Your ticket can be used in any 2 adjoining zones.

Hope that clears that up for you.
